Dear Mr. Camilli

By letter dated June 14, 2023 (Agencywide Documents Access and Management System (ADAMS) Accession No. ML23180A012), Electric Power Research Institute (EPRI) submitted the Motor-Operated Valve (MOV) Performance Prediction Methodology (PPM), Version 4.1, 3002023774, to the U.S. Nuclear Regulatory Commission (NRC) for review and approval.

The EPRI MOV PPM software was developed to enhance industry's ability to size MOV s and predict their performance.

By email dated March 19, 2024, the NRC staff issued its draft safety evaluation (SE) (ADAMS Accession No. ML24053A342) for proprietary review.

By email dated March 20, 2024 (ADAMS Accession No. ML24080A156), EPRI informed the NRC staff that there was no proprietary information in the draft SE.

As described in the final SE, the NRC staff determined that EPRI has justified the changes made in the EPRI MOV PPM, Version4.1, for determining the thrust and torque required to operate valves under dynamic flow conditions. Therefore, the NRC staff concludes that the EPRI MOV PPM, Version4.1, is acceptable for use by nuclear power plant applicants and licensees were implemented in accordance with the provisions of the EPRI MOV PPM and the previous SEs prepared by the NRC staff on the EPRI MOV PPM. In reaching this conclusion, the NRC staff relies on the review described in this SE and previously issued SEs for overall acceptability of the EPRI MOV PPM.

Our acceptance applies only to material provided in the subject TR. We do not intend to repeat our review of the acceptable material described in the TR. When the TR appears as a reference in license applications, our review will ensure that the material presented applies to the specific plant involved. License amendment requests that deviate from this TR will be subject to a plant-specific review in accordance with applicable review standards.

In accordance with the guidance provided on the NRC website, we request that EPRI publish an accepted version of EPRI Report 3002023774, EPRI MOV Performance Prediction Methodology (PPM), Version 4.1, within three months of receipt of this email. The approved versions shall incorporate this letter and the enclosed final SE after the title page. The accepted version shall include an A (designating accepted) following the TR identification symbol.
